If you are potential seller in the Omaha real estate market you have many choices when it comes to hiring an agent. Not all agents are created equal and even agents within the same company has varying degrees of success and experience.
Any agent you speak with will TELL you all about their internet and technology expertise. How can you really tell? One way to test this is to send a potential agent a TEXT message. Agents that are technology savvy understand the POWER of texting and the importance of communicating in today's marketplace. The demographic for the average buyer in today's market is the low to mid 30's. Times have changed and the buyers in today's marketplace DEMAND instant communication.
So, before you hire an agent send them a text message. Sending a simple text may save you a tremendous amount of time and it will put you in contact with an agent who has the capability of communicating with the buyers in today's marketplace.

Excellent thread, we are now using TXT.COM on our real estate yard signs and it is incredible. Potential buyers can drive up, text in the numbers and get immediate information on the home they are looking at. It then alerts me that someone has just TEXTED in on my listing with their phone number and name so I can do an immediate call up and follow thru on any further questions they may have...
